What You Need To Know Ahead Of Marvell Technology's Earnings Report
~1.4 mins read

Marvell Technology (MRVL) is set to report second-quarter results for fiscal 2025 after the bell Thursday, with investors likely to be watching for signs the semiconductor tech company could be poised for a turnaround in sales and updates on its artificial intelligence (AI) initiatives.

Analysts project second-quarter revenue of $1.25 billion, down from $1.34 billion a year ago, according to estimates compiled by Visible Alpha. The company is expected to post a net loss of $159.45 million or 18 cents per share, narrowing from the year-ago period.

Investors are likely to be watching for signs that the company has reached the bottom of its recent decline in sales, as strength in its data center segment has struggled to offset weakness in its other areas.

Deutsche Bank analysts expect roughly flat sequential performance across Marvell's non-data center businesses, Carrier, Enterprise Networking, and Auto/Industrial, with an "uncertain pace of recovery" in the second half of the year.

Rosenblatt analysts said they believe the company has "reached a cyclical bottom," with the AI business trajectory poised to gain in the long term.

Investors will likely be watching for updates on Marvell's Data Center segment and its position in the AI landscape.

Rosenblatt analysts expect Marvell management to reiterate expectations that AI sales will exceed $1.5 billion in fiscal 2025 and $2.5 billion in fiscal 2026.

Marvell shares were down close to 4% at $69.04 in intraday trading Monday ahead of the company's earnings Thursday, though they've gained over 14% since the start of the year.

Just In: NFF Appoints Germany’s Bruno Labbadia As New Super Eagles Coach
~0.4 mins read

NFF has appointed Germany’s Bruno Labbadia as new Super Eagles coach.

The Nigeria Football Federation has announced that it has reached an agreement with German tactician, Bruno Labbadia, to become the Head Coach of Nigeria’s Senior Men National Team, Super Eagles.

NFF General Secretary, Dr. Mohammed Sanusi, said in the early hours of Tuesday: “The NFF Executive Committee has approved the recommendation of its Technical and Development SubCommittee to appoint Mr. Bruno Labbadia as the Head Coach of the Super Eagles. The appointment is with immediate effect.”

General Mills Hopes Travis And Jason Kelce Can Be Its Lucky Charms
~1.2 mins read

General Mills (GIS) is bringing football’s most-famous brothers to the cereal aisle. 

The owner of Lucky Charms, Cinnamon Toast Crunch and Reese’s Puffs is teaming up with Kansas City Chiefs star Travis Kelce and former Philadelphia Eagles standout Jason Kelce to create the Kelce Mix, which combines the three breakfast cereals in one box, General Mills said Monday.

The company hopes a Kelce bump will help drive buzz amid a difficult consumer environment. General Mills in late June posted fiscal fourth-quarter sales that were down 6.3% year-on-year to $4.71 billion, below the consensus estimate of analysts surveyed by Visible Alpha, and issued a disappointing forecast. WK Kellogg (KLG) separately said earlier this month that full-year sales growth could end up negative.

In addition to their football careers, Jason and Travis Kelce have amassed a following for their “New Heights” podcast, a recent episode of which covered their favorite cereals. Both brothers were recently at a party hosted by Taylor Swift, according to reports.

General Mills, meanwhile, put the brothers through their paces at a recent “cereal training camp,” content from which will appear on television and in online advertising. with the Kelce Mix available starting next month.

Shares of General Mills were edging higher Monday afternoon. They're up about 9% so far this year. Kellogg's shares have fared better in 2024, rising some 35%.

Leadership Crisis: Obaseki’s Struggles To Reassure A Fractured PDP Camp Before Crucial Election
~1.6 mins read


Panic Grips Obaseki's PDP Camp Ahead of September 21 Governorship Election
 
With the September 21 state governorship election fast approaching, anxiety within the camp of incumbent Governor Godwin Obaseki is intensifying. Reports of growing panic within the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) faction supporting Obaseki are spreading, and it has emerged that key figures in his inner circle have unsuccessfully attempted to meet with the governor to address their concerns.
 
A reliable source, who is part of the governor’s inner caucus, expressed dismay at the current situation just weeks before the election. The source, speaking on condition of anonymity due to fear of repercussions, admitted to reconsidering his support for both Obaseki and Asuen Ighodalo, the governor’s chosen successor and the PDP’s candidate.
 
Reflecting on their failed attempts to discuss the issue with Obaseki, the source stated, "I’m completely fed up with what’s going on. Not only is the party hemorrhaging support, but His Excellency (Obaseki) is not doing anything to improve the situation. We can’t even get access to him."
 
He continued, "Despite everything we’ve heard and seen, several of us have tried to meet with His Excellency to clarify things, provide reassurance, and restore some confidence as we head into this crucial election. But so far, our efforts have been completely rebuffed. I may have to reconsider my position and my support for the PDP-Obaseki camp, and I will make my decision public within the next two weeks after consulting with my supporters."
 
The source added that his supporters in Edo South have been asking questions that he cannot answer without risking his credibility. "I can’t deceive them; it would cost me my hard-earned respect and support. Let’s wait and see. By the next two weeks, I’ll make my position clear."
 
Further investigations revealed that the sentiment among the dwindling number of PDP loyalists in Obaseki’s camp is similar, with many expressing deep concern about the numerous challenges facing the party.
 
"I’m not comfortable with the situation right now. Not many are willing to speak out, but it’s very worrisome," said another party leader.
